Bonelli Landing, Lake Mead

Bonelli Landing is located on the south side of Lake Mead in Bonelli Bay. It is public land managed by the National Park Service, and available to the public for recreational purposes.

Temple Bar Airport

Temple Bar Airport is a public use airport in Mohave County, Arizona, United States. It is one nautical mile (1.85 km) southwest of the Temple Bar Marina, located on Lake Mead's Temple Basin. The airport is owned by the U.S. National Park Service.

Temple Bar, Lake Mead

Temple Bar is on the Arizona side of Lake Mead between Bonelli Landing and Greggs Hideout. Lake Mead, and all of its points of interest, is managed by the National Park Service and available to the public for recreational purposes.

Temple Bar Marina

Temple Bar Marina is a marina on Lake Mead in the U.S. state of Arizona. The site includes a full-service marina with boat rentals, lodging at the motel-like Temple Bar Resort, a restaurant and lounge, and an RV park. Temple Bar Marina is the closest marina on Lake Mead to Phoenix. Temple Bar Marina has its own post office with ZIP code 86443. Temple Bar Airport is located near the marina.

Lake Mead

Lake Mead is the largest reservoir in the United States in maximum water capacity. It is located on the Colorado River about 24 mi from the Strip southeast of Las Vegas, Nevada, in the states of Nevada and Arizona. Formed by the Hoover Dam, Lake Mead is 112 miles long when the lake is full, has 550 miles of shoreline, is around 500 feet at greatest depth, has 247 square miles (640 km) of surface, and when filled to capacity, 28 million acre-feet of water.
